Technical Overview
Built to 28 AWG specifications, this telephone cable delivers the appropriate gauge for standard voice applications while maintaining manageable cable diameter. The flat profile reduces bulk and allows for cleaner routing under carpets, along baseboards, or through tight spaces where round cables might create installation challenges.
Both ends feature bare wire termination, providing maximum flexibility for custom connector installation. This approach supports various termination methods including punch-down blocks, screw terminals, or custom connector crimping based on specific installation requirements.

FAQ
What is the exact length of this telephone cable?
The Monoprice 952 telephone cable measures 1000 feet in total length, which is equivalent to 304.8 meters. This substantial bulk length makes it suitable for wiring multiple stations or covering extended distances in office environments, between buildings, or throughout larger residential properties.
What type of connectors are on each end of the cable?
Both ends of the cable feature bare wire termination with no pre-installed connectors. Each end has 1 x bare wire, providing maximum flexibility for custom termination to match your specific installation requirements. This allows for connection to punch-down blocks, screw terminals, or custom connector installation based on your equipment.
What does '28 AWG' mean for this telephone cable?
28 AWG refers to the American Wire Gauge standard, indicating the diameter of the individual conductors within the cable. 28 AWG is a common gauge for telephone applications, providing the appropriate balance between current-carrying capacity and physical flexibility. This gauge ensures reliable signal transmission for voice communications while maintaining manageable cable diameter.
What are the advantages of the flat cable design?
The flat design offers several practical advantages: it reduces installation bulk, allows for easier routing under carpets or along baseboards, minimizes tripping hazards when installed across floors, and provides a cleaner appearance when run along walls or through visible areas. The low profile also makes it easier to paint over or conceal in finished spaces.
